Commute from ONT-KC would be easy. XJT does it direct a a couple times a day from all of our bases. Any of the bases would have a decent commute. I think CHQ does it for the COEX side, not sure but i believe they are weight restricted alot. If you get ONT, or SAT there are alot of MCI overnights which would be perfect for you. Upgrade at XJT is 2 years and steady there. New bid just came out on the first for 96 more upgrades which is the largest upgrade bid we have done in a long time its usually 64. No training contract with XJT. Good luck either way. Definitely do both interviews though.
